read-cellnow works on error cells and non-numeric formula cells without throwing an exception. (All cell types now handled safely).
Error cells return keyword of the error type:
:VALUE :DIV0 :CIRCULAR_REF :REF :NUM :NULL :FUNCTION_NOT_IMPLEMENTED :NAME :NA

added font and cell styling options (contributed by naipmoro):
-
added option work on the legacy Excel 'XLS' file format (
create-xls-workbook) -
added font styling options to
create-font!::name (font family - string) :size (font size - integer) :color (font color - keyword) :bold (true | false) :italic (true | false) :underline (true | false)
-
added styling options to
create-cell-style!::background (background colour - keyword) :font (font | fontmap of font options) :halign (:left | :right | :center) :valign (:top | :bottom | :center) :wrap (true | false - controls text wrapping) :border-left (:thin | :medium | :thick) :border-right (:thin | :medium | :thick) :border-top (:thin | :medium | :thick) :border-bottom (:thin | :medium | :thick)

- Use type hints to call correct overload for setting nil date (contributed by mva)
- Introduces remove-row! and remove-all-rows!.
- Adds row-vec function to create row data for adding to sheet from a struct to ease writing select, transform, write-back tasks.
- Formulas are now evaluated when they are read from the sheet and the resulting value is returned.
- Added named ranges functions add-name! and select-name (contributed by cbaatz).
- Added row style functions set-row-style! and get-row-styles for styling rows (contributed by cbaatz).
- Introduces cell styling (font control, background colour).
- A more flexible cell-seq (supports sheet, row or collections of these).
- Updated semantics for reading blank cells: now they are read as nil (formerly read as empty strings).
